    Payment Processing

    We use Stripe as our payment processor to handle all subscription payments securely.

    What payment data we collect

    • We do NOT store full credit/debit card numbers, CVV codes, or complete card details on our servers
    • Stripe securely stores your payment method and provides us only with the last 4 digits of your card, card type, and expiry date for display purposes
    • We store your billing name and address for invoicing purposes
    • Transaction records (amounts, dates, invoice numbers) are stored in our system

    PCI-DSS Compliance

    Stripe is a PCI-DSS Level 1 certified payment processor — the highest level of certification in the payment industry. Your payment information is handled with industry-leading security standards. See Stripe's Privacy Policy.

    Recurring Billing

    By subscribing to PayCamp, you authorise us (via Stripe) to charge your payment method on a recurring basis according to your chosen billing cycle. You can update or remove your payment method at any time via your account settings.

    PayCamp Payments (Payment Facilitation)

    When a site owner enables PayCamp Payments, their customers (guests) can pay for bookings and invoices online via a secure checkout page. In this context:

    • Guest payment data: Guest card details are submitted directly to Stripe and are never stored on PayCamp servers. We receive only the last 4 digits of the card, transaction amount, and payment status.
    • Data shared with site owners: Payment confirmation, amount paid, guest name and email address are shared with the site owner for their records.
    • Data shared with Stripe Connect: Guest payment details are processed by Stripe under their Privacy Policy. PayCamp never accesses or stores full card numbers.
    • Transaction records: We retain records of facilitated transactions (amounts, dates, status, fees) for a minimum of 7 years for accounting and regulatory compliance.

    Data Privacy Shield

    PayCamp offers an optional Data Privacy Shield that provides enterprise-grade data isolation. When enabled:

    Database-level blocking

    Row Level Security rules physically prevent our admin accounts from querying your sensitive tables — customers, invoices, bookings, and payments. Enforced at the database layer, not by policy.

    Temporary support access

    If you need help, you can grant our team scoped, time-limited access (24 hours, 48 hours, or 7 days). Access auto-expires and can be revoked instantly.

    Full transparency

    Every admin access event is logged in your Transparency Dashboard with timestamps, scope, and identity. There is no way for us to access your data without it appearing in the audit trail.

    Payment credential protection

    Your Stripe API keys are stored encrypted and shielded behind the same privacy rules. We never see your payment credentials or hold funds on your behalf.

    We built it so we physically cannot access your data when Privacy Shield is enabled — not just that we promise not to. The database enforces it, not a policy document.
